    Specifications

    HS Code

    112922

    Product Name Neusol Yellow CE-01
    Appearance Yellow powder
    Chemical Class Monoazo pigment
    Color Index Pigment Yellow 1
    Cas Number 2512-29-0
    Shade Bright yellow
    Oil Absorption 45-55 g/100g
    Light Fastness 5-6 (1=poor, 8=excellent)
    Heat Stability Up to 180°C
    Specific Gravity 1.6 g/cm³
    Ph Value 6.0-7.5 (aqueous suspension)
    Moisture Content ≤2.0%
    Residue On 80 Mesh ≤5%
    Solubility Insoluble in water
    Main Applications Plastics, paint, inks, coatings

    Packing & Storage
    Packing Neusol Yellow CE-01 is packaged in a 25 kg blue HDPE drum with a red lid, featuring clear product labeling.
    Shipping Neusol Yellow CE-01 is shipped in tightly sealed, labeled containers to prevent moisture and contamination. Packaging complies with chemical safety standards, typically in 25 kg fiber drums or HDPE bags. All shipments include safety documentation and are handled according to local and international transport regulations for non-hazardous industrial chemicals.
    Storage Neusol Yellow CE-01 should be stored in a tightly sealed container, away from direct sunlight, heat sources, and moisture. Keep it in a cool, dry, and well-ventilated area, ideally between 5°C and 30°C. Avoid contact with incompatible materials, such as strong acids and oxidizing agents. Always follow local regulations and safety guidelines when storing this chemical.
